Welcome aboard! The Splitgate service assigns users to A/B experiment arms for all Norvette products. Assignments are deterministic: a hash of user ID and experiment salt, so never change a salt mid-experiment or you'll reshuffle cohorts and invalidate results. Config changes go through the review queue and take effect within five minutes of merge. Deploys to the assignment tier are gated — the pipeline rejects any unsigned artifact. To sign your first deploy, configure your toolchain with the key below.

signing key of kagup-bawef = bky6_xSzaa3

### Deploy step 4 — renderer credentials

The Inkmoor markdown rendering pipeline sanitizes untrusted input in a sandboxed worker before HTML is cached. For review purposes, note that the sandbox fetches its sanitizer ruleset from the internal policy service over mTLS, and the cache-signing step runs only if that fetch succeeds. The worker's env file must therefore contain, directly after the TLS paths, the following line.

sealed setting: ARCHIVE_KEY3=8d0

Ticket #: Missed Pick-up — Notarised Deed

The Harrowgate Title deed envelope was not collected yesterday; the Swiftmere courier arrived after dock close. Envelope remains in the secure cabinet, seal intact. Re-booked for tomorrow, 10:00 slot, west dock. Shift lead to witness the release and apply the confidential hand-over step stated below.

handover note for yagef-bagep: the drudor pelius courier leaves the kasdor zorvan norir ledger at gate 8016 under passcode 755406

# Crossword Forge — Environment Variables

Crossword Forge reads all config from .env at startup. GRID_SIZE and THEME_PACK have sane defaults; override only for local testing. WORDLIST_URL points at the Lexigon dictionary mirror — don't change it unless the mirror moves. Never commit .env; it's gitignored for a reason. Dictionary requests are authenticated, so each developer needs their own Lexigon access token. Request one from the platform channel, then add it on the line immediately after this sentence.

secret setting of yagef-baweg: RELAY_SECRET29=cb53deb59a49ed54d9f43599b54ca